California LifeLine Program Helps Keep People Connected; Free Multilingual Guide Available

Staying connected to local resources and emergency services is vital to the state's low income and elderly residents and can even help save lives. AT&T* California has joined with Consumer Action, a non-profit advocacy and education organization, to promote the state's important California LifeLine program during national "Lifeline Awareness Week," September 14-20.
The purpose of National Lifeline Awareness Week is to ensure that eligible low-income consumers are aware of the LifeLine program and are able to obtain affordable telephone service through the assistance of this program. Public Utilities Commissions and phone carriers in states across the U.S. are working to get the word out on this important program.
"California's LifeLine telephone program is the best in the country. The cost is low and no other state comes close to the number of consumers that benefit," said Ken McEldowney, Executive Director of Consumer Action. "Unfortunately, many who are eligible aren't on the program yet."
"Ensuring those in need have access to affordable phone service has been a priority since 1983 when the California Legislature passed a law creating the LifeLine program," said Senator Alex Padilla (D-Pacoima). "This program helps low-income households and others in financial need stay connected while staying within their budgets. I wholeheartedly support this program."
"Californians living on fixed incomes owe it to themselves to find out if they qualify for the LifeLine program," said Ken McNeely, President, AT&T California. "They could receive basic phone service at significant discounts and that could make a real difference in their lives."
Under the LifeLine program, qualifying consumers receive discounted local phone service. All California telephone companies that provide residential service offer the California LifeLine program. As more and more consumers struggle to pay their bills in today's tough economy, it's more important than ever for everyone to be aware of this program so they can stay connected. The LifeLine program, administered by telephone companies and sponsored by the California Public Utilities Commission, provides low-income Californians with discounted home phone service they can rely on. Millions of Californians already take advantage of the LifeLine program.
Rules established by the California Public Utilities Commission (CPUC) allow customers to qualify for the program in one of two ways:
* By participating in an approved public assistance program including: Medicaid/Medi-Cal, Supplemental Security Income (SSI) or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P).
* By meeting certain household income limits.
To help provide consumers with detailed information on the program and how to apply, Consumer Action in partnership with AT&T has launched a multi-phase consumer outreach initiative.
The first phase is making a new Lifeline guide available. Consumers can see the publication online at or send a stamped, self-addressed, legal-sized envelope to Consumer Action, 221 Main St., Suite 480, San Francisco, CA 94105. The guide is available in Chinese, English, Korean, Spanish and Vietnamese. In your request, please indicate the language you want.
The second phase set for later this year is to provide in-depth "train the trainer" sessions for community based organizations in the state so they can educate their clients about the California LifeLine program.
Consumers can also contact their phone carrier directly and ask about the program.
AT&T California customers can call 800-446-5651 (English) or 800-882-0521 (Spanish) or go online to website.

About Consumer Action
Consumer Action is a San Francisco-based national education and advocacy organization founded in 1971. Its multilingual educational programs reach consumers through Consumer Action's national network of more than 11,000 community based contacts - with more than 3,500 located in California - and on the group's website. The non-profit organization also has offices in Los Angeles and Washington, DC.
